Creators and makers are really just people that like to plan ideas. Matt has been a creator his entire life. It started covered in sawdust in the basement woodshop with his father and grew into so much more. In the 12 years Matt has been with Wilkus Architects, he has successfully created numerous projects across various project typologies and scales, including commercial, hospitality, and retail. What he learned in the wood shop directly translates to how he approaches design.  Woodworking requires thoughtful research and planning for each material you pick and cut you make. Architecture requires the same thoughtfulness and diligence to arrive at elegant, effcient, and exciting results. In woodworking, they say “measure twice, cut once”; as an architect, he believes “iterate with the pen, not the saw”.
